Amid (Japanese: アミッド Amid) is a scion of Grannvale's House Friege, and the son of its late Lady Ethnia. He was raised in Silesse, left behind when his uncle Bloom came to abduct his mother and his sister Linda, eventually setting out to travel south upon hearing rumors of Linda's presence in Ulster. Travelling with Fee/Hermina, he joined Seliph's liberation army in Isaach while en route to Ulster.

Amid is Arthur's substitute character, filling Arthur's role in the story and gameplay if Tailtiu died or failed to be married in the course of the first generation.

Biography

During their journey to Ulster, Amid and Fee/Hermina made a stop to give her pegasus a rest near Isaach Castle in the middle of the fight between Seliph's group and Danann's army. When Fee/Hermina told him her story of wanting to join Seliph's army, he volunteered to join it too.

Fire Emblem: Genealogy of the Holy War

Role

Amid is a playable character during the second generation. As Arthur's substitute character, Amid only appears if Tailtiu wasn't married or was dead at the end of Chapter 5. In Chapter 6, he, along with Fee/Hermina, appear as player units once Ganeishire has been seized.

See love for more details on the love system.
  • In Chapter 6, Amid can talk to Seliph after he has joined his party. This conversation yields no reward.
  • In Chapter 7, Amid can talk to Linda when she appears as an enemy, recruiting her.
  • In Chapter 8, Amid can talk to Fee/Hermina at any time, granting her +3 maximum HP and 100 love points between the pair.
  • In Chapter 8, if Amid waits on the northern tree in the map's central valley with the river, he will initiate an event where he meets Jake, granting him +3 Resistance.
  • In the Endgame, Amid can talk to Linda if neither has a lover, granting her +1 Luck.

Analysis

This character analysis section may not be accurate to every player's experience.

Amid joins in Chapter 6 as a level 2 Wind Mage. His base stats are on par with Arthur's average stats. Amid also has Adept, giving him a chance to attack twice in a row based on his attack speed. Since he wields a Wind tome, the lightest basic tome in Genealogy, his attack speed will be solid, giving him a decent activation rate. However, Amid does not have Follow-Up, so he cannot double enemies reliably. On the flip side, he is stuck with Wind or Elwind until he promotes, and the latter is only obtained in Chapter 9's armory, or unless Ced inherited it; consequently, he is stuck with the 8-MT Wind for a large chunk of the game; even with Adept, he will not have enough damage to one-round enemies.

Amid's growths are surprisingly workable with 40/50/40 in MAG/SKL/SPD, enough to average capping all three at Lv30. His 90% HP growth is also on the high side for spellcasters. However, like many other substitute units, he requires more resources to keep up and be good at combat. Unlike Arthur, he never becomes mounted, since he promotes to Mage Fighter and not Mage Knight. While Mage Fighter has better statistical bonuses, the movement disparity makes it inferior. His combat does become quite serviceable once promoted; promotion gives Amid the ability to use Thoron, which has enough damage to defeat most enemies with Adept, along with a +6 DEF boost that substantially improving Amid's survivability when facing multiple enemies; he may not one-round every enemy, but he will usually kill between a half and a third with Adept. However, his lower mobility limits his ability to reach the front line, and his dependency on Adept makes him unreliable when his damage is badly needed. He is also unable to inherit any skills or holy blood, while Arthur can either get Forseti or Follow-Up from his father.

Without investment, Amid is a mediocre, foot-locked combat unit with no utility. Even among substitute units, he is below average. With investment, he can become competent at combat, but will never do amazing things.

Personality

Though others easily get the opposite impression as a result of his sarcastic tendencies, Amid is kind and helpful even to complete strangers, as evidence by his asssistance of Jake when he encountered him lost in the Munster District.[1] He possesses a strong disdain for the Friege family as a whole for their abduction of Ethnia and Linda.[2]
